WebThe Cook County Clerk serves as the chief election authority for the entire county, the third largest election jurisdiction in the nation. Along with administering elections in suburban Cook County, the Clerk's office maintains birth, marriage and death records, assists property owners in redeeming delinquent taxes, and records the activity of the Cook … WebAdministers elections for suburban Cook County’ s 1.4 million registered voters, which entails voter registration, judge recruitment and training, and polling place identification, mapping and management.
